Evictions on the rise months after federal moratorium ends



By Associated Press -December 29, 2021 10:00 AM

As pandemic-related assistance is rolled back, Americans across the country are experiencing a fresh wave of hardship.

Soon after losing his trucking job amid the pandemic, Freddie Davis got another blow: His landlord in Miami was almost doubling the rent on his Miami apartment.

Davis girded for what he feared would come next. In September he was evicted — just over a month after a federal eviction moratorium ended. He's now languishing in a hotel, aided by a nonprofit that helps homeless people.

The 51-year-old desperately wants to find a new apartment. But it's proving impossible on his $1,000-a-month disability check.
